Immigrants from Poland vs Immigrants from Eastern Europe Single Male Poverty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 269,525,262 people shows a poor posit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Poland and poverty level among single males in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.106 and weighted average of 11.5%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 407,915,677 people shows a significant posit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Eastern Europe and poverty level among single males in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.609 and weighted average of 11.8%, a difference of 2.6%.
